Keith Wood withdraws from squad to face Romania

Ireland Captain Keith Wood has had to withdraw from the squad for Saturdays game against Romania due to the death of his brother, Gordon.

Keith’s place in the Irish team will be taken by Shane Byrne, with Ulster’s Paul Shields called to the replacements bench.

IrishRugby.ie would like to offer our deepest sympathies to Keith and his family.
